Top 5 Best Victoria County Public High Schools (2024)

For the 2024 school year, there are 7 public high schools serving 4,107 students in Victoria County, TX.
The top ranked public high schools in Victoria County, TX are Victoria East High School, Victoria West High School and Bloomington High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Victoria County, TX public high schools have an average math proficiency score of 19% (versus the Texas public high school average of 37%), and reading proficiency score of 35% (versus the 47% statewide average). High schools in Victoria County have an average ranking of 1/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Texas public high schools.
Victoria County, TX public high school have a Graduation Rate of 94%, which is more than the Texas average of 90%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Victoria East High School, with 98%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Texas or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 76%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Texas public high school average of 73% (majority Hispanic).
